Oxygen is close to picking up a nonfiction series starring outspoken Dallas chef Blythe Beck, according to sources close to the project.
The cabler said no deal has been made for the half-hour, but sources close to the network confirm "The Naughty Kitchen" has thus far been well received in test screenings.
Series, which revolves around the brassy, ambitious five-star chef Beck and the colorful cast of characters at her upscale Dallas restaurant, is produced by Code Entertainment and Authentic Pictures.
Larry Kennar and Rick Berg serve as exec producers for Code, and Lauren Lexton and Tom Rogan exec produce for Authentic. Brandy Menefree and Brad Hall are showrunners and exec producers.
Also in active development at NBC Universal-owned Oxygen are "The Girls," which focuses on three young singers trying to break into Nashville, and "Hogs and Heifers," which highlights the goings-on at the eponymous bar franchise.
